As the 67th voyage made its way across the South Pacific Ocean, it was time to celebrate Japan’s southernmost prefecture – Okinawa. A week of activities culminated with Okinawa Night on November 16. Here, participants from the Okinawan islands onboard treat their fellow participants to traditional Okinawan music.

Even at sea, sport lovers embrace every opportunity to engage in their favorite past time. Men and women teamed up in the Peace Ball soccer tournament on November 14.
A one-day table tennis tournament on November 18 was another feature on the onboard calendar. Over 50 participants battled it out in single and double games.
A number of wellness activities take place onboard the 67th voyage each morning. One popular event is Laughing Time. Participants gather in a large circle and share the contagious joy of a good laugh.
A three-month journey around the world offers unforgettable memories at every turn. Participants displayed their favorite pictures from the voyage in a series of photo exhibitions onboard.
Peace Boat offers the rare opportunity to visit the mysterious moai on Rapa Nui (Easter Island). Kimura Yuumi puts the final touches on her personalized moai in an art workshop ahead of Peace Boat’s arrival on the remote island.
